No I don't have VEPro. But I doubt it would solve the issue as you can't host VSTs with Reason in slave mode anyways. So, even if you somehow hosted Reason i VEPro without it being in slave mode, you'd still have to route the MIDI from Pro Tools to Reason to play a part, and then route the audio back from Reason to Pro Tools to lay down the track. I can do that now using virtual midi and the loop back audio feature on my Focusrite interface. So, I don't see how adding VEPro makes that any different. I just open Reason then Pro Tools to do things this way if I want to use patches created using VSTs in Reason. Mainly its in the Combinator in Reason that I do that. If I'm just going to use a single instance of a particular VST VI, then I can just host it directly in PT using Reaper or Patchwork.

Now, if Blue Cat made a Reason version of Patchwork...then that would make it so you can host VSTs in Reason while in Slave mode. Just host them in PW inside Reason. But, the REAL solution is for the P-heads to simply upgrade Reason to allow VST hosting while Reason is in slave mode. Frankly I don't see why that's an issue now. Reaper can host VSTs when in slave mode...it can't be that hard to pull off programming wise.

The other thing I want to see if MIDI cable routing similar to how we can route cables now on the back of the rack. Imagine if you had 2 MIDI out ports on, say, the Dual Arp Player, and could route Arp 1 to one VI and Arp 2 to a different one. Combinator set ups using that could become quite complex and textured. You could have a MIDI splitter, similar to the audio or cv splitters if you wanted to send a MIDI out to several VI's MIDI INs at one time.

Right now, MIDI functionality is very limited in Reason.
